https://www.acmicpc.net/problem/26736
난이도 : 브론즈 4
태그 : 구현, 문자열
설명
이번엔 폴란드어 문제입니다.
러시아어에 정들려 했다가 이젠 폴란드어의 등장입니다.
사실 지문을 보지 않아도 입력과 출력만 봐도 문제의 내용을 유추할 수 있습니다.
A와 B의 개수를 각각 카운트하여 출력하는 것 같네요
소스코드
fun main() {
val line = readln().toCharArray()
println("${line.count { it == 'A' }} : ${line.count { it == 'B' }}")
}
코틀린의 람다식을 활용하여 쉽게 풀이하였습니다.
'코딩테스트 > Kotlin' 카테고리의 다른 글
[백준 7489번] [Kotlin] 팩토리얼 (0) | 2023.01.17 |
---|---|
[백준 1343번] [Kotlin] 폴리오미노 (0) | 2023.01.17 |
[백준 7785번] [Kotlin] 회사에 있는 사람 (0) | 2023.01.17 |
[백준 6996번] [Kotlin] 애너그램 (0) | 2023.01.16 |
[백준 10699번] [Kotlin] 오늘 날짜 (0) | 2023.01.16 |